Northwest Indiana African American Alliance (NWIAAA) regularly produces community events designed to advance our vision and mission.

Join Northwest Indiana African American Alliance, Inc.

Honoring our community leaders for a special celebration recognizing the outstanding contributions of individuals who make a difference in our community

 Come and show your support for:

                                                                        

                                                                       Ivan Bodensteiner – community legal advocacy

                                                                                 Emily Hoffman – community generosity

                                                                             Pastor Tomas Angon – community outreach

Saturday, May 31, 2025

1 p.m. – 3 p.m.

First Presbyterian Church

3401 Valparaiso Street

Valparaiso, IN 46383

A light lunch will be provided
